About this item

  • Neutral Density ND Filter; giving great versatility in changing light; reduces the amount of light without effecting color balance; perfectly neutral color will not alter the natural color of the moon
  • High-quality optical lenses; made by completed professional optical glasses; Multi-layer coating; ND8 filter transmits only 12.5% of the incoming light; it has outstanding image sharpness and perfect colour neutrality
  • 1.25'' barrel diameter; metal filter cell threads directly into the 1.25 inch barrel of your telescope eyepiece; useful for different caliber astronomical telescopes through which the light of the moon can be extremely overwhelming
  • Great Filter Frames; Filter Frames made by aluminum alloy; the serrated design of the edge of the frame makes it easy to install;Increase surface durability

Specifications

Type: Neutral Density Filter
Material: Aluminum Frame, Metal Thread and Optical Glass
Barrel diameter: 1.25''
Optical density value: 0.9
Transmission: 12.5%
Thread: Standard M28.5*0.6mm
Net Weight: 5.0g / 0.19oz/0.08lb
Glass Thickness 2mm
